The secret to decorating a beautiful Christmas tree is similar to decorating any room in your home: Layer it up with style! The usual decorative elements of the Christmas tree are lights, garlands, tinsel and ornaments. Whatever your favorite aesthetic, these staple pieces are familiar to just about everyone. The best Christmas trees are filled with memories, traditions and memories. There’s an art to decorating a Christmas tree, but there’s also a science. While we all have our own unique decorating style, the following steps can help anyone create seasonal decorations.

Every beautifully decorated Christmas tree starts with the foundation. If you’re working with faux wood, lift and separate the branches and tips to lose the “wrapped” look. This creates a fullness that opens pockets for hanging lights, ornaments, and wreaths. Work in layers: place the first section on the stand, inflate it and climb the tree. When decorating a living tree, place the best side out. You can use a pair of gloves to keep the sharp bristles away. Finely trim the branch where needed to create a more uniform look.

Consider putting a cover on the tree first to set the tone for the decoration and avoid disturbing the ornaments. Seasonal symbols like angels and stars are classic choices, but large poinsettias or burlap bows can be an unexpected and unique choice. If you’re using a non-traditional topper, mix it up by filling in the spaces with picks, flowers, or faux berries.

Many artificial trees already come with lights. It’s time to turn them on to make sure they work. Start at the base of the tree and work your way up wrapping lights around each larger branch. Make sure you add lots of lights to the back of the tree to create extra sparkle and depth. Once the lights are around the tree, step back and look for areas that need more or less adjustment to get more or less light through the branches.

Target a few spots on the tree to group ornaments, picks, flowers, and ribbons by size. This step creates focal points that give your eyes a place to rest. Vary the size and shape of the ornaments to add depth and interest. For a coherent design, try to match the color of the selected areas to the top.

There are no hard and fast rules for hanging out the wreath, but I recommend starting at the top and placing it as far towards the end of the branch as possible until you feel safe. Starting at the top and slowly raising the garland between each wave will help keep the branches from swelling between the tightly twisted strands of the garland. Plan to use about two strands of garland for each vertical leg of the tree.

Instead of the garland, you can also decorate with ribbon if you loosely wrap a wide patterned ribbon around the tree. Use ribbons to make big bows to decorate tree branches. Varying the width of the ribbon can add visual intrigue, and tucking the ribbons in different spots helps with flow.

The amount of ornamentation used is a matter of individual taste. Whether you want a full, densely decorated tree or prefer a minimalist approach, add ornaments inside the branches. If you’re working with multiple colors, distribute each group around the tree before moving on to the next batch to ensure proper color balance.

Stunning Christmas Trees Decorated For Some Holiday Sparkle

If you want to display your favorite ornaments, place them in the best places on the tree first. So start with the large ornaments and place them as deep into the center of the tree as the branches will allow. This way they stay stable and fill in uneven spots. Hang them as high on the tree as is convenient, but plan to use medium and small ornaments higher up. Then it’s time to place medium-sized florets further up the branches. Finally add some small decorations in the outer part of the branches, where the scales will not be lost and the weight will not move the branch.

Hanging some ornaments closer to the trunk will add depth and interest. They reflect light so that the wood shines from within. Stand back and study the wood from different angles to determine if any blank areas need to be filled in.

The wooden skirt offers functionality and gives a trendy look. It captures pins and sets the stage for beautifully wrapped gifts.
